find: missing argument to `-exec'
时间: 2024-04-19 12:24:22 浏览: 97
这是一个错误提示,意思是在使用“-exec”命令时缺少了参数。在使用“-exec”命令时,必须在其后面指定要执行的命令和参数,例如:
find /path/to/directory -name "*.txt" -exec rm {} \;
这个命令将在指定目录中查找所有扩展名为“.txt”的文件,并将它们删除。在这个命令中,“-exec”后面的“rm {} \;”就是要执行的命令和参数。如果缺少了这些参数,就会出现“missing argument to '-exec'”这个错误提示。
相关问题
linux中find: missing argument to `-exec'
在Linux终端中,`find`命令用于搜索指定目录及其子目录,并执行指定的动作(如打印、删除、移动文件等)。当你看到`find: missing argument to '-exec'`这样的错误提示时,这意味着你在尝试使用`-exec`选项时忘记提供了必要的参数。
`-exec`选项通常需要跟一个动作命令和可能的管道符号(`;` 或 `&&`)以及可以传递给该命令的一个或多个参数。基本语法如下:
```bash
find [path] [expression] -exec [command] [arguments] ;
```
例如,如果你想查找所有的`.txt`文件并使用`ls`命令列出它们:
```bash
find /home/user -type f -name "*.txt" -exec ls -lh {} \;
```
在这里,`-type f`表示查找普通文件,`-name "*.txt"`指定了文件名模式,`ls -lh {}`是你想要执行的命令,`{}`会被替换为找到的每个匹配项,`\;`用于结束`-exec`选项。
如果你没有提供这个完整的结构,就会收到`missing argument to '-exec'`的错误。请检查一下你的`find`命令行,确保`-exec`后面跟着合适的命令和参数。如果还有疑问,请提供具体的`find`命令,我可以帮你分析。
find missing argument to -exec
引用和中描述了在使用find命令时出现"find: missing argument to '-exec'"的问题。这个问题通常是由复制和粘贴命令时包含不可见字符导致的。复制的命令中可能包含了空格、换行符或其他不可见字符,这会导致find命令无法正确解析命令参数。解决这个问题的方法是手动输入命令而不是复制粘贴,确保命令中不包含任何不可见字符。所以,解决这个问题的方法是手动输入命令而不是复制粘贴,确保命令中不包含任何不可见字符。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[find:用终端UI包装find(1)](https://download.csdn.net/download/weixin_42131618/18794954)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
- *2* *3* [maven install 命令提示Missing argument for option: f问题](https://blog.csdn.net/wengkevin/article/details/107281067)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
阅读全文